    Enlisted to Officer Rank Ceiling?

    Hi everyone! Just a quick question: What is the highest officer rank someone can achieve after having first been enlisted?

    The highest I've personally met was a captain. I've asked my recruiter and he doesn't have a definite answer but he thinks that its Colonel. I'll be going to boot camp soon and I have dreams of making Brigadier General as a JAG. Is it possible?

    Well, lets see......
    Lieutenant General Lewis Burwell "Chesty" Puller began his Marine Corps career as an enlisted Marine as well as General Alred M. Gray, who was the Marine Corps 29th Commandant.

    It depends on the route you take to become an officer. If you commission as an unrestricted officer (the majority of officers are unrestricted), the sky is the limit. If you commission as a Limited Duty Officer (LDO), then LtCol is the limit. LDOs are specialist officers, much like warrant officers are.
